NOTICE OF PRIVACY PRACTICES

Effective April 14, 2003

THIS NOTICE DESCRIBES HOW MEDICAL INFORMATION ABOUT YOU MAY BE USED AND DISCLOSED AND HOW YOU CAN GET ACCESS TO THIS INFORMATION.

We respect client confidentiality and only release confidential information about you in accordance with the Illinois and federal law. This notice describes JVS’ policies related to the use of the records of your care generated by this agency.

USE AND DISCLOSURE OF PROTECTED INFORMATION

In order to effectively provide you care, there are times when JVS will need to share your confidential information with others beyond our agency. This includes:

  • Treatment - We may use or disclose treatment information about you to provide, coordinate, or manage your care or any related services including sharing information with others outside JVS that we are consulting with or referring you to.
  • Payment - With your written consent, information may be used to obtain payment for the treatment and services provided.
  • Health Care Operations - JVS may use information about you to coordinate its business activities. This may include setting up your appointments, reviewing your care and training staff.

INFORMATION DISCLOSED WITHOUT YOUR CONSENT

Under Illinois and federal law, information about you may be disclosed without your consent in the following circumstances:

  • Emergencies - Sufficient information may be shared to address the immediate emergency you are facing.
  • Follow-Up Appointments/Care - We will be contacting you to remind you of future appointments or information about treatment alternatives or other health-related benefits and services that may be of interest to you. We will leave appointment information on your answering machine/voice mail unless informed otherwise.
  • As Required by Law - This would includes situations where we have a subpoena, court order or are mandated to provide public health information, such as communicable diseases, suspected abuse and neglect or institutional abuse.
  • Coroners - We are required to disclose information about the circumstance of deaths to a coroner pending an investigation.
  • Government Requirements - We may disclose information to a health oversight agency for activities authorized by law such as audits, investigators, inspectors and licensure. If requested we are required to share information with the U.S. Department of Health and Human Services to determine JVS’ compliance with federal laws related to health care and with the Illinois state agencies that fund our services.
  • Criminal Activity or Danger to Others - If you are involved in a crime committed on JVS’ premises or against its personnel or we believe someone is in danger, information may be shared with law enforcement.
  • Fundraising - As a non-profit provider of health care services, we need assistance in raising money to carry out JVS’ mission. JVS may contact you to seek a donation.

CLIENT RIGHTS

You have the following rights under Illinois and federal law:

  • Copy of Record - You are entitled to inspect the client record JVS has generated. You may be charged a reasonable fee for copying and mailing your record.
  • Release of Records - You may consent in writing to release your records to others for any purpose you choose. This could include your attorney, employer or others who wish to have knowledge of your care. You may revoke this consent at any time, but only to the extent no action has been taken in reliance of your prior authorization.
  • Restriction of Record - You can request JVS not disclose part of the clinical information. This request must be in writing. Jewish Vocational Service is not required to agree to your request if it is believed that it is not in your best interest to withhold use and disclosure of the information. The request should be given to the Privacy Contact.
  • Contacting You - You may request that JVS send information to another address or by alternate means. JVS will honor such a request as long as it is reasonable and we are assured it is correct. JVS has the right to verify that the information you are using for payment is correct.
  • Amending Record - If you believe something in your record is incorrect or incomplete, you may request it be amended. To do this, contact the Privacy Contact and ask for the Request to Amend Health Information form. In certain cases, JVS may deny your request. If your request for amendment is denied and you disagree, you have the right to file a statement. Your statement and JVS’ response will be placed in your record.

CLIENT RIGHTS

Accounting for Disclosures
You may request an accounting of any disclosure JVS has made related to your confidential information, except for information used for treatment, payment or health care operations purposes, or that was shared with your family, or information you gave specific consent to release. It also excludes information JVS was required to release. To receive information regarding disclosures made for a specific time period, no longer than six years and after April 14, 2003, please submit your request in writing to JVS’ Privacy Contact. You will be notified of the cost involved in preparing this list.

Questions and Complaints
If you have any questions or complaints, or wish an additional copy of this Policy, you may contact the Privacy Contact in writing at the JVS office for further information. You may submit a complaint to the U.S. Department of Health and Human Services if you believe JVS has violated your privacy rights. There will be no retaliation against you for filing a complaint.
